COMPANDING
Companding is a collective term to define
comp
ressing the audio signal on transmission and
exp
anding
the audio signal on reception. The
overall effect is to reduce noise in the received
signal, giving you crisper, clearer audio clarity.
Companding should only be used when other radios
in your system have the same companding feature
available.
You can switch Companding
On
or
Off
by using a
pre-programmed
Companding
button.
1.
Press the
Companding
button to switch Com-
panding
on
, when the feature enable alert will
sound.
2.
Press the
Companding
button again to switch
Companding
off
, when the feature is disabled
an alert will sound.
LOCAL / DISTANCE
Distance is the standard mode of operation, and
maximises receive radio range.
Local reduces interference from other radios in
close proximity and is typically used for base station
configurations.
You can switch between
Local
and
Distance
by
using a pre-programmed
Local/Distance
button.
Using the Local/Distance Button
1.
Press the
Local/Distance
button to switch to
Local
when the feature enable alert
will sound.
2.
Press the
Local/Distance
button again to
switch to
Distance
when the feature
disable alert
will sound.
